About this route:
A direct, nonstop flight between Cabinda Airport (CAB), Cabinda, Angola and Milton Keynes Airport (KYN), Milton Keynes, England, United Kingdom would travel a Great Circle distance of 4,055 miles (or 6,526 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Cabinda Airport and Milton Keynes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Cabinda Airport (CAB):
- The furthest airport from Cabinda Airport (CAB) is Canton Island Airport (CIS), which is located 11,799 miles (18,989 kilometers) away in Canton Island, Kiribati.
- The closest airport to Cabinda Airport (CAB) is Muanda Airport (Moanda Airport) (MNB), which is located 26 miles (41 kilometers) SSE of CAB.
- Because of Cabinda Airport's relatively low elevation of 66 feet, planes can take off or land at Cabinda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
- Cabinda Airport (CAB) currently has only 1 runway.
- In addition to being known as "Cabinda Airport", other names for CAB include "Aeroporto de Cabinda (Cabinda)" and "Aeroporto de Cabinda".
